One of the most prominent avenues for earning in Web3 is through Decentralized Finance (DeFi). DeFi platforms are essentially rebuilding traditional financial services – lending, borrowing, trading, and insurance – on the blockchain, without the need for intermediaries like banks.
Consider yield farming and liquidity mining. These DeFi strategies allow you to earn rewards by providing your crypto assets to decentralized exchanges or lending protocols. When you deposit your tokens into a liquidity pool, you're essentially enabling others to trade those tokens. In return for this service, you receive a share of the trading fees, and often, additional tokens as incentives. It's akin to earning interest on your savings, but with potentially much higher returns, albeit with a higher degree of risk. The key is to understand the underlying protocols, the tokenomics of the rewards, and to diversify your holdings to mitigate potential impermanent loss – a risk inherent in providing liquidity.
Another DeFi staple is staking. This involves locking up your cryptocurrency holdings to support the operations of a blockchain network. Proof-of-Stake (PoS) blockchains, for instance, rely on stakers to validate transactions and secure the network. By staking your coins, you contribute to this security and, in return, earn staking rewards, typically in the form of more of the same cryptocurrency. It’s a passive income stream that requires minimal active management once set up, making it an attractive option for long-term holders. However, it's vital to research the staking mechanisms, lock-up periods, and the overall security of the network before committing your assets.
Beyond DeFi, the burgeoning creator economy within Web3 presents a treasure trove of opportunities for artists, writers, musicians, and any content creator. Non-Fungible Tokens (NFTs) have revolutionized digital ownership, allowing creators to mint their unique digital works – be it art, music, videos, or even tweets – as NFTs. These tokens, recorded on the blockchain, provide verifiable proof of ownership and authenticity. For creators, this means they can sell their digital creations directly to their audience, cutting out intermediaries and retaining a much larger share of the revenue. Furthermore, many NFT platforms allow creators to embed royalties into their NFTs, ensuring they receive a percentage of every subsequent resale of their work, creating a perpetual income stream.
Imagine a digital artist selling a piece of their work as an NFT for the first time. The sale not only provides immediate income but also secures a lifelong royalty percentage for every time that artwork is traded on secondary markets. This fundamentally shifts the power dynamic, enabling creators to build sustainable careers directly from their digital output. The accessibility of minting platforms has lowered the barrier to entry, democratizing the art market and allowing a wider range of creators to find an audience and monetize their talents.
